Product Overview

The Sun Gold Power 13kW Off Grid Solar Kit is a complete residential power system built around high-capacity inverters, large-scale lithium storage, and a full-size solar array. Designed on a 48V platform with split-phase 120/240V output, it supports standard household circuits and higher-demand equipment from a single integrated system. With 25.6kWh of LiFePO4 battery storage and 22 high-output solar panels, this kit is suited for homes, cabins, and remote properties that rely on dependable, self-managed power for daily living.

With two 6500W inverters delivering 13,000W of combined capacity, the system supports split-phase 120/240V power that matches typical residential wiring. That means household-style circuits, tools, pumps, and climate equipment can operate within a familiar electrical framework.

The 48V architecture provides a stable foundation for moving energy efficiently between panels, batteries, and inverters. This platform is commonly used in larger systems because it supports higher power levels without excessive losses. In daily operation, that translates into more predictable performance under load.

Battery storage plays an equally important role. The included five 51.2V 100Ah lithium iron phosphate batteries deliver a combined 25.6kWh of usable capacity. This level of storage allows energy collected during the day to carry through evenings, nights, and early mornings with less pressure to conserve. It gives you room to operate normally instead of constantly monitoring usage.

The enclosed battery cabinet adds structure to long-term ownership. By housing the batteries in a dedicated enclosure sized for up to six units, it keeps the system organized and leaves space for future expansion. This reduces clutter, simplifies maintenance, and supports gradual system growth without major redesign.

On the generation side, the 22 bifacial N-type monocrystalline panels provide a 9.9kW solar array. This level of input supports strong daily energy production and helps replenish storage consistently. The bifacial design offers additional collection potential when installed over reflective surfaces, adding another layer of efficiency without changing the system footprint.

Technical Specifications

  • Inverters: 2 × 6500W units
  • Total Inverter Capacity: 13,000W
  • DC Input Voltage: 48V
  • AC Output: 120V / 240V split-phase
  • Battery Type: LiFePO4 (Lithium Iron Phosphate)
  • Battery Configuration: 5 × 51.2V 100Ah
  • Total Battery Storage: 25.6kWh
  • Battery Cabinet Capacity: Up to 6 batteries
  • Solar Panels: 22 × 450W bifacial N-type monocrystalline
  • Total Solar Array Output: 9900W
  • Solar Extension Cables: 4 sets × 50 ft
  • Inverter to Busbar Cables: 2 sets × 2/0 AWG
  • Mounting Hardware: 22 sets of Z-brackets
  • DC Breakers: 2 × 200A
  • PV Breakers: 4 × 25A

What’s Included

This kit includes two 6500W 48V inverters with 120/240V output, twenty-two 450W bifacial N-type solar panels, five 51.2V 100Ah LiFePO4 batteries totaling 25.6kWh, one enclosed battery cabinet, four 50 ft solar extension cable sets, two 2/0 AWG inverter-to-busbar cable sets, twenty-two sets of Z-brackets, two 200A DC breakers, and four 25A PV breakers.
